Output 75d037cd93eca30db2537bb91a2f8e5b73a4312d0ebc235c72914d2cbb65ff8b:0

value
2824567115
script pubkey
OP_0 OP_PUSHBYTES_20 9339f40747db52b4ab27e3414dd700661c35d70a
address
tb1qjvulgp68mdftf2e8udq5m4cqvcwrt4c2ulxrx7
transaction
75d037cd93eca30db2537bb91a2f8e5b73a4312d0ebc235c72914d2cbb65ff8b
confirmations
109958
spent
true